Pre-order the latest video game set in J.K Rowling's Harry Potter universe and get 15% off of your purchase! This open-world action RPG lets you live the Hogwarts experience fully and all pre-orders get an Onyx Hippogriff Mount to sweeten the deal.
The Standard Edition will be released on February for $50.99 (regularly $59.99), but if you preorder the Deluxe Edition for $59.49 (regularly $69.99) you can not only get 72 Early Access to play on February 7 but also bring home a Thestral Mount, Dark Arts Battle Arena, Dark Cosmetics Set, and Dark Arts Garrison Hat. The game is available for PC only, but it is supported in multiple languages so preorder fast to be part of the action once it releases.
Sale is live for a limited time. Keys ship out on February 7 for the Deluxe Edition and February 10 for the Standard Edition.

- All footage has currently been from the PS5 version
- 30 FPS "fidelity" mode or 60 FPS "performance" mode - the performance mode looks pretty cut down in terms of visual quality in a lot of places
- I've seen quite a bit of pop-in with characters during open world traversal (i.e. on the broom)
- Quite a few restrictions on where you can land on the castle when on the broom
I would never pre-order a game or buy a key from somewhere that you can't refund (unless the quality of the game is a known quantity)....
But especially here, the lack of PC hands-on so far should really give people pause about pre-ordering even if there is a discount. Waiting for the first couple of patches to smooth out rough edges is likely to be the best plan (as usual).
